  • Dr. Johnson Asiamah nominated to lead the Bank of Ghana, pending approval
  • Former Deputy Governor brings decades of experience in monetary policy and financial stability

Accra, Ghana – President John Dramani Mahama has nominated Dr. Johnson Asiamah to serve as the next Governor of the Bank of Ghana, subject to approval by the Council of State. His nomination follows the decision of Dr. Ernest Addison to take leave ahead of his retirement on March 31, 2025.
